Fight between taxi drivers in La Laguna, Tenerife: “I’ll take you and scratch your head”

two taxi drivers San Cristobal de La Laguna They got involved this Saturday morning, around 12:30 p.m., in a fight in which, after insulting each other out loud, they came to blows. Both taxi professionals were with their vehicles parked at the stop on Avenida de la Trinidad.

According to several witnesses, the two drivers began to argue until they got out of their vehicles to continue the dispute and the insults in the middle of the street, even interrupting the traffic that was circulating in the area.

The altercation was so big that several people began to videotape the fight. In these images, the two men can be seen grabbing and struggling while threatening each other. One of them goes as far as to say to the other: “I’ll take you and blow your head” and “I’ll take you and blow you up, clown”, is heard in the audio of one of the videos broadcast on social networks and through instant messaging.

It is studied to withdraw the licenses

The City Council of La Laguna, before these very serious events carried out by the two taxi drivers on public roads and during his service hours, he shows his total rejection of images that cannot be tolerated. The Corporation already is studying the appropriate measures, including the withdrawal of the licenseto prevent behavior of this type from occurring again in a public service that has always been characterized by its professionalism.
